Understanding the Mechanics of the Aviator Game

At its heart, the Aviator game is about timing. A virtual plane takes off, and a multiplier begins to increase. Players place a bet and watch as the multiplier climbs. The longer the plane flies, the higher the multiplier becomes, and the larger the potential payout. However, at any moment, the plane can ‘crash’, resulting in a loss of the wager. The key to success lies in predicting when the multiplier will reach a desirable level and cashing out before the crash occurs. Mastering this timing is easier said than done, contributing to the demand for tools promising a greater degree of predictability.

Statistical Analysis vs. Algorithmic Predictions

Statistical analysis tools typically focus on examining historical data, looking for patterns or biases in the game’s results. While they can provide some insights into past performance, it’s crucial to remember that each round is independent, and past results don’t necessarily predict future outcomes. Algorithmic prediction tools, on the other hand, attempt to leverage more complex mathematical models. These models may consider factors like the seed value used by the random number generator, or attempt to identify subtle correlations in game data, but the randomized nature of the game inherently limits their accuracy. The premise of reliably predicting a truly random event remains a fundamental challenge.

Evaluating the Effectiveness of Aviator Predictors

The critical question remains: do Aviator predictors actually work? The answer is complex and nuanced. While some tools may offer marginal improvements in profitability, it’s essential to understand their limitations. The game’s underlying randomness makes it impossible to predict outcomes with absolute certainty. Even the most sophisticated algorithms are susceptible to unpredictable fluctuations. Many claims regarding accuracy are often based on limited data sets or backtesting scenarios that don’t accurately reflect real-world game conditions.

Identifying and Avoiding Scam Predictors

The market is unfortunately populated by deceptive tools. Be wary of any predictor that makes unrealistic promises (e.g., guaranteed winnings), requires upfront fees with no clear explanation of the service, or lacks transparency about its methodology. Look for independent reviews and testimonials from reputable sources. Consider joining online forums and communities to discuss experiences with different tools.
